In 1916 There Were 14 Passenger Trains a Day Running Through Vermont; Their History is FascinatingLongtime Amtrak employee and lover of all things railroad,Bill Brigham, gave a speech in Randolph about the history ofwhat would become The Vermonter route from Washington,D.C. to Montreal.Compass Vermont thanks Ginger Brigham Cook for sharingher father’s speech with us so that we could share it with you.Welcome.There is interesting history here in Randolph.In 1845 there was a movement headed by Governor Paineof orthfield to build the railroad from hite iver to ssex, but the other proposal was to go through the east sideby way of illiamstown ulf.overnor aine had land and business in orthfield so itwas built his way and through est andolph. y skippingMontpelier and Barre there were investors in those towns thatweren’t happy to be on a branch line instead of the mainline.There was a small station built in 1850 along with a freighthouse on the other side of the tracks. Parts of the originalfreight house were moved across the tracks to be incorporatedinto a new structure,The new station was built in similar in design to randon and St. Armand, Quebec. The freight house was built onthe other side where we know it now. est andolph becameRandolph and the town grew towards the railroad.The new station incorporated a bay window for the operatorto see the trains coming and also the west side of the interiorwas for women and the east side was for men. The clock wasgiven to the station by the local grange and they maintained ituntil 1941 when it was given to the town.It was a manual wind and wound by a town employee oncea week.People were eager to have a good passenger train servicebecause of dirt roads and bad tires.In there were passenger trains a day through andolph. In 1931 there were 10 trains a day.In between, there was the flood which tore out a lot oftrack on the railroad. entral ermont couldnt afford to rebuild and it was sold at auction to the anadian ational ailroad who financed the reconstruction and service was restored.There were businesses that used the freight services Salisbury Furniture, the three milk plants oods, hiting, andUnited Farmers, grain and farm supplies astern States,Dustin, and irthmore, L.. reenwood got farm euipmenton flat cars.The freight house received damaged freight from the CV inSt. Albans and it was auctioned off here in Randolph under thecanopy at the station.e bought a bathtub and my wifes desk at those auctions,but I remember how my father got a case of Corn Flakes thatseemed to go on forever.Over the years there have been special movements. One thatcomes to mind is a train made up of 39 Pullman cars that weregoing to Halifax to pick up stranded passengers because thereBill Brighamwas a dock strike in New York.In 1965 there were still six passenger trains a day. One eventthat I remember occurred when my sister and I were on thetrain to Bethel where we went for piano lessons each week.There were often four or five men in three piece suits and hatswho would get on here in Randolph and get off in Bethel.hen my lesson was over I would walk back to the stationand they would be sitting against the fence with paper bags.I would go into the station to hear the telegraph and the bellthat would ring when a train cleared Roxbury, and read oldtimetables from other railroads.The train would come in and we and the men would get onthe train. The men then would proceed to give the conductor ahard time all the way to Randolph.Later I learned andolph was a dry town and ethelwet. After a few minutes, the conductor would open the cardoor and call out andolphandolph. ack then there wasa gum machine on the side of the station which for a pennyyou could get a wrapped piece of gum.There was a guy who would get off the Railway Postal carand pick up the mail from the east and west mailboxes thatwere on each end of the platform. In the springtime chickswould come in (the peep chorus) and be in the waiting roomuntil they were picked up.In 1955 there were three sections of the Barnum and Baileycircus train that came through with steam engines. e went tothe Circus in Montpelier that night.In 1995 the word came down that they were going to closedown the Montrealer and it was fought for but lost. But theState of ermont came up with a plan to run a statesubsidizedtrain from St. Albans to Springfield, ass.I took the last Montrealer south and at St. Albans saw theeuipment for the ew ermonter. The next day it was welcomed at various stations on the route.Later I heard indsor was applying for a stop, I thoughtandolph is halfway between ontpelier Jct. and hite iverJct. and Carolyn Tonelli who represented the village trusteestown government, applied for a stop in Randolph.Senator Aiken had said many people who had moved toermont wanted to travel back to ew York and so that philosophy was in place ...
